There is a bike ratios spreadsheet available on line, if you can't find it, I can send you a copy.

 

I have never heard of a 145/80 10" tyre, you can't use a 10" wheel with a Z Cars mini conversion the brakes are only just able to go under certain 13" wheels.

 

In order to calculate speeds you also would need to know the numbers of teeth on the front and rear sprockets then you can work out top speed. etc
